Highland Park is located in Calgary’s city centre region and got its name from the area’s high elevation.

Known for its mature trees, rolling hills, and community-oriented atmosphere, Highland Park offers a balanced lifestyle with a mix of suburban peace and easy access to urban amenities. The neighborhood appeals to home buyers who appreciate its close proximity to downtown, scenic green spaces, and affordable housing options.

The neighbourhood offers easy commutes for its residents, and going to the airport is not a problem with the quick and easy access provided by McKnight Blvd. Deerfoot Trail and the Edmonton Trail also offer a quick drive to downtown Calgary.
The community is served by several reputable schools that include Buchanan School, James Fowler High School and Colonel Irvine School. Outside the neighbourhood, there are plenty of excellent schooling options for the kids. See our list of schools nearby here.
West of the community is The Foothills Medical Centre and the Alberta Children’s Hospital, one of Calgary’s largest hospitals. The hospital offers comprehensive medical services, including emergency care, specialized treatments, and outpatient services, ensuring residents have access to high-quality healthcare.
Highland Park has a friendly, welcoming atmosphere, with a mix of long-time residents and new families moving into the area. Its combination of older homes and redevelopment creates a diverse community feel.
Highland Park is located in the city centre region of Calgary and bordered by Tuxedo Park, Thorncliffe, Highwood and Confederation Park.

The community itself is named after its central park, Highland Park, a green space that offers playgrounds, walking paths, and areas for picnics and relaxation. The neighborhood’s many green areas provide a peaceful retreat for residents.
Just a few minutes away is Confederation Park, Nose Hill Park, the Highland Golf Course, and the exclusive Calgary Winter Club and its superb recreational facilities. Avid bicyclists living in Highland Park homes enjoy easy access to the city bike paths. An outdoor skating rink can be found here as well.

South of the neighborhood features several local businesses, including cafes, restaurants, and specialty stores along Centre Street and Edmonton Trail. These businesses cater to everyday needs and provide a convenient place to grab coffee or a quick meal.
For more extensive shopping needs, Deerfoot City and North Hill Centre are a short drive away, offering a range of retail stores, grocery stores, and dining options.
Many of the original homes in Highland Park date back to the 1950s and 1960s, featuring bungalows and split-level houses.
The variety of housing types—from older bungalows to modern infill homes—makes Highland Park appealing to a broad range of buyers, from first-time homeowners to those seeking luxury urban living.
